In 2019 the NBA brought the future of the sport to Walt Disney World’s 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ex in the form of the Jr. NBA Global Championships. The event features the top 13- and 14-year-old boys and girls basketball plays in the world.

Make plans to be at ESPN WWOS August 13-16 to see 16 domestic and 16 international teams compete against each other for the title of Jr. NBA Global Champions.

Last year saw the US Central region girls team repeat as Jr. NBA Global Champions while the US West team claimed the title for the boys.

The event features an opening ceremony along with skills and slam dunk competitions.

Jr. NBA Global Championship Skills Competition

The Jr. NBA Global Championship is a great event for the athletes as in addition to the tournament games, they get to compete in ‘friendly’ matches with international players.

The big games get the full TV sports broadcast experience complete with announcers, half-time entertainment, and player profiles.

Stars of the NBA and WNBA are also on hand to provide some coaching and important life skills as the young players begin their journey of excellence on and off the court.
